Output 74e570302819bcbcd9bbc6fd89df247b9830b95a65181a575f10bacb5c252a5d:1

value
8437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651623bfbff9288ccdcc59d8b1890387aa05ce0e OP_EQUAL
address
3AuWhD2JxCvRAoAgH98qF6mGuQmBcMNjGp
transaction
74e570302819bcbcd9bbc6fd89df247b9830b95a65181a575f10bacb5c252a5d
spent
true